On the question of debugging user-exits here are some notes I made when I did it. The user-exit was completely different but with luck something similar should work for you:

Debugging UXTAVQ0R; This is the Inventory Maintenance user exit which updates the GRN for RP transactions.

? Find the iSeries job of the power-link session.
○ In the Help-Diagnostics-Proc Connection object scroll to the top and you'll see a message such as:
§ Job 493376/QUSER/QZRCSRVS started on 04/09/14 at 10:30:29 in subsystem QUSRWRK in QSYS. Job entered system on 04/09/14 at 10:30:29.
? On green-screen
○ STRSRVJOB JOB(493376/QUSER/QZRCSRVS)
○ STRDBG PGM(TEST9/UXTAVQ0R) UPDPROD(*YES) OPMSRC(*YES)

I would like to include an edit on a Create transaction in the "Bill of Material Component" business object.

I have added an entry on the "Edits" card of the BOMCMP business object, and generated the program (UMDCUN0R) successfully. Under certain conditions, I need to prevent an Item from being include/added to a BOM.

I have tried to follow "KB1520968 Attachment Code File Delete Edit" as the basis for modifying the program with no success. I added the code, but didn't get the desired error displayed.

If anyone can send me an overview of the various Edit Scopes, and when they should be used, it would be of great assistance. If there is a general overview of how to modify the Integrator User Exits, it would also be a great help.

Furthermore, I know that the modified program is being accessed during the edit of a Component Create, as I have checked the last date used on the object, but I would like to be able to de-bug the program once it is compiled and ready for testing.
